Kids Art Classes

Kids' art classes are educational programs designed to nurture creativity, develop fine motor skills, and encourage self-expression in children through various artistic activities such as painting, drawing, sculpture, and crafts. These classes often promote exploration of different mediums and techniques in a fun and supportive environment.

Key Features

  • Structured curriculum tailored for different age groups
  • Hands-on activities with a variety of art supplies
  • Focus on creativity, self-expression, and skill development
  • Experienced instructors or art teachers
  • Group settings that promote social interaction
  • Possibility of showcasing or displaying children's artwork

Pros

  • Encourages creativity and self-expression in children
  • Develops fine motor and cognitive skills
  • Builds confidence through artistic achievement
  • Offers a fun, engaging way for kids to learn
  • Can foster an interest in art and related fields

Cons

  • Quality of classes can vary depending on the instructor
  • May be limited by class sizes or materials available
  • Some children may lose interest if activities are not sufficiently engaging
  • Additional costs for supplies or enrollment fees
